Wachenbrunn is a district of the city of Themar in the Hildburghausen district in Thuringia .

location

Wachenbrunn is located southwest of Themar on the country road 2628 in the Werraniederung and in a hilly, natural area of ​​the rural area.

There was a radio transmission system in the medium wave range, the Wachenbrunn transmitter, close to the town .

history

Wachenbrunn was first mentioned in a document in 1220. Other sources mention the year 1319. Historically, there has always been a connection to Themar. In terms of lordship, the place in the Themar office initially belonged to the county of Henneberg , after 1583 to various Saxon duchies and from 1826 to 1918 to Saxony-Meiningen . In 1920 he came to the state of Thuringia .

The Church of St. Johannis was built in 1870 as a rectangular building in the neo-Romanesque style according to plans by Meiningen building councilor August Wilhelm Döbner .
